A triangular prism cigar former
By designing a triangular cigar shaper, which combines a mold base and a mold cover to form a triangular shaping cavity mold, the problem of shaping quality of triangular cigars was solved, and efficient production of multiple cigars and guarantee of appearance quality were achieved.

Technical Field
[0001] This utility model belongs to the technical field of cigar production equipment, and in particular relates to a triangular prism cigar shaper. Background Technology
[0002] The shaping of cigar wrappers is a crucial step in the production of handmade cigars, ensuring that the cigars have a good appearance. The quality of the shaping directly affects the quality of the next wrapper application process, thus impacting the quality of the finished cigar.
[0003] Currently, most cigar wrapper shaping uses the Robert type cigar shaper, which is a cylindrical wrapper shaper; there are no triangular wrapper shapers. Furthermore, compared to cylindrical cigars, triangular cigars are more difficult to shape with consistent quality. Utility Model Content
[0004] In view of the defects or deficiencies in the existing technology, this utility model provides a triangular cigar shaper that can produce triangular cigars and produce multiple cigars at one time, thereby improving the appearance quality and shaping quality of the cigars.

[0025] The present invention will be further described below with reference to the accompanying drawings and embodiments.
[0026] A typical embodiment of this utility model is as follows: Figure 1As shown, a triangular cigar shaper includes a mold base 1 and a mold cover 2. Both the mold base 1 and the mold cover 2 are made of hardwood. The upper surface of the mold base 1 is provided with a shaping cavity 3, and the bottom surface of the mold cover 2 is flat. When the mold cover 2 is closed with the mold base 1, a shaping cavity mold is formed between the mold cover 2 and the mold base 1. The shaping cavity mold has a triangular prism structure. The tobacco blank to be shaped is placed in the shaping cavity 3. When the mold cover 2 is closed with the mold base 1, the triangular prism tobacco blank is shaped by the shaping cavity mold between the mold cover 2 and the mold base 1. After the wrapper is added to the triangular prism tobacco blank, a triangular cigar is formed.
[0027] Specifically, such as Figure 2 and Figure 3 As shown, multiple shaping cavities 3 are arranged side by side on the upper surface of the mold base 1. The multiple positioning cavities 3 have the same shape and size, so that the shaped tobacco blanks have a consistent shape and ensure the appearance quality of the tobacco blanks. The shaping cavity 3 is a V-shaped groove, the length of which is less than the width of the mold base 1, and one end of the shaping cavity 3 is set through the side of the mold base 1. The multiple shaping cavities 3 are arranged in parallel on the mold base 1, and the distance between two adjacent shaping cavities 3 is equal, so that multiple triangular tobacco blanks can be shaped at one time.
[0028] An isolation protrusion 4 is provided between two adjacent shaping cavities 3. The isolation protrusion 4 is used to separate the adjacent cigar tobacco blanks, so as to avoid the two adjacent shaping tobacco blanks from contacting each other and affecting each other, which would result in quality defects in the appearance of the cigar.
[0029] The top surface of the isolation protrusion 4 is a plane. When the mold base 1 and the mold cover 2 are closed together, the top surface of the isolation protrusion 4 is in contact with the bottom surface of the mold cover 2, thereby ensuring the molding quality of the cigarette blank in the molding cavity.
[0030] like Figure 4 As shown, the mold cover 2 is provided with a plurality of positioning pins 5, and the mold base 1 is provided with a plurality of positioning grooves 6. The positioning pins 5 are correspondingly arranged with the positioning grooves 6. When the mold cover 2 and the mold base 1 are closed together, the plurality of positioning pins 5 on the mold cover 2 are inserted into the corresponding positioning grooves 6 on the mold base 1, thereby ensuring a tight fit between the mold base 1 and the mold cover 2.
[0031] A concave groove 7 is provided on one end face of the mold base 1. When the mold cover 2 and the mold base 1 are closed together, the top of the concave groove 7 contacts the bottom surface of the mold cover 2, so that a cavity is formed between the mold cover 2 and the mold base 1 on this side, thereby facilitating the separation of the mold cover 1 and the mold base 2.
[0032] Working principle
[0033] In use, the tobacco blank to be shaped is placed into the shaping cavity of the mold base, and the mold cover is placed on the mold base so that the lower surface of the mold cover fits tightly against the upper surface of the mold base. Under the mutual compression of the mold cover and the mold base, the tobacco blank to be shaped is shaped into a triangular tobacco blank in the shaping cavity. After the wrapper is added to the triangular tobacco blank, it becomes a triangular cigar.
